The school closed in 2004, and boarded up.

Here are some of the headlines from the Rochdale Observer, leading up to the closure:

  • April 2001 – “Shrinking pupils mean big problems for closure-threatened schools”
  • April 2002 – “Why can’t they leave us alone”?
  • September 2002 – “Merger plan to close schools”
  • October 2002 – “School axe hovers again”
  • October 2002 – “Who’s next on the list?”
  • October 2002 – “Oakenrod parents: “we don’t want this merger”
  • October 2002 – “Park safety fear in school protest”
  • November 2002 – “This is a fight to the finish”
  • December 2002 – “Last-ditch bid to save school under threat”
  • December 2002 - Record goes on report”
  • January 2003 – “School boycott fears”
  • March 2003 – “Closure still looms at cost-shock school”
  • March 2003 – “Mum will go it alone”
  • April 2003 – “D-Day for schools in battle against closure”
  • June 2003 – “It’s the end for Oakenrod”
  • July 2004 – “School marks top class finish”
  • July 2004 – “Schools out with a smile and a tear”
